There's a family member in my life whom I told a secret to and they told someone else. The resulting feelings I got from the person they told knowing my secret is a big sense of feeling ashamed and basically "what's the point of anything now?" I realize this reaction is extreme and I'm wondering how to fix it and not react this way anymore. Is it just a matter of boosting my self-esteem so that something like this wouldn't bother me in such a big way anymore?
